035Providing an online marketplace for buyers and sellers of goods authenticated by non-fungible tokens (nfts); providing an online marketplace for buyers and sellers of goods authenticated by non-fungible tokens (nfts).ACTIVE
042User authentication services using blockchain technology for ecommerce transactions; Providing a web hosting platform for facilitating ecommerce transactions; Hosting a members-only website featuring technology which provides members with the ability to access multiple databases for the purpose of purchasing crypto-collectible and blockchain-based non-fungible tokens; Providing temporary use of online non-downloadable computer programs for blockchain data storage; Providing temporary use of online non-downloadable computer programs to manage purchases and sales of non-fungible tokens; Providing temporary use of online non-downloadable computer programs for managing the purchase and sale of non-fungible tokens; Providing computer system design in the field of blockchain governanceACTIVE
